Runbook: Glintmap tile cache (owned by the Farrow team). If hit rate drops below 80%, flush only the vector layer keys, never the full store — raster rebuilds take hours. Restart cachelet workers one at a time. Before promoting a release, confirm the live settings match the block below.

settings of fafog-haduf:
ZORIX_PIN=4648
ZORIX_METRICS_HOST=metrics.zorix.paliqsys.corp
ZORIX_LOG_LEVEL=info
ZORIX_TENANT=druix

## Sweeper: reclaim orphaned resources

Adds a background sweeper to the Mirelet provisioning stack. Finds volumes, load-balancer stubs, and DNS stubs whose owning workspace was deleted, marks them, then reclaims after a grace period. Dry-run on by default; enable reclaim per environment. No API changes. Rollback: disable the feature flag, marks expire harmlessly. Tested against staging snapshots from the Oskett cluster. Grace periods and batch limits are set by the constants below.

limits module of fajog-tawig:
RATE_LIMITS = {
    "druwyn": 2,
    "quenael": 10,
    "wenix": 2,
    "druael": 2,
}

- [ ] **Step 7: Breaker override escrow.** After sealing the signing keys for the Tallgrove upstream API circuit breaker, confirm the support team can force the breaker open during a full outage. The override bundle lives in the sealed escrow drawer and is useless without its unlock phrase. Two ceremony witnesses must initial this step before proceeding. The escrow bundle is decrypted with the recovery passphrase that follows.

vault phrase of kahip-kahop = holath-quenmir

This step migrates the Cobblewick inventory reconciliation job from the legacy nightly runner to the new Tidemark executor. Before cutover, freeze stock adjustments for the Ashfold region and let the final legacy run complete; a partial run leaves ledger rows in a mixed state that the new job cannot repair automatically. Verify the last-run marker, then disable the legacy trigger. Do not enable both triggers simultaneously. Once the legacy job is confirmed off, apply the executor's configuration values shown below.

config for bagep-kageg:
ULADOR_LOG_LEVEL=warn
ULADOR_METRICS_HOST=metrics.ulador.tolvaqcorp.corp
ULADOR_POOL_SIZE=32